加入收藏 | 设为首页 | 会员中心 | 我要投稿 草根网 (https://www.1asp.com.cn/)- 建站、低代码、办公协同、大数据、云通信!
当前位置: 首页 > 教程 > 正文

MsSql存储优化:触发器应用与性能提升实战指南

发布时间:2026-03-07 12:14:51 所属栏目:教程 来源:DaWei
导读:  在数据库优化过程中,触发器的合理应用可以显著提升MsSql的存储效率和数据一致性。触发器是与表相关联的特殊存储过程,当特定的数据操作(如INSERT、UPDATE、DELETE)发生时自动执行。通过触发器,可以在数据变更

  在数据库优化过程中,触发器的合理应用可以显著提升MsSql的存储效率和数据一致性。触发器是与表相关联的特殊存储过程,当特定的数据操作(如INSERT、UPDATE、DELETE)发生时自动执行。通过触发器,可以在数据变更时自动执行一些预定义的操作,比如日志记录、数据验证或同步其他表。


  在实际应用中,触发器常用于维护数据完整性。例如,在更新订单状态时,可以通过触发器自动更新库存数量,确保业务逻辑的一致性。这种机制避免了手动编写重复代码,提高了开发效率,同时也减少了出错的可能性。


  然而,触发器的使用需要谨慎,因为不当的触发器设计可能影响性能。过多的触发器会导致执行时间增加,尤其是在频繁进行大量数据操作的场景下。因此,建议对触发器进行性能分析,避免复杂的逻辑嵌套,并尽量减少不必要的操作。


  为了提升性能,可以采用异步处理或队列机制来优化触发器的执行。例如,将部分非实时操作放入消息队列中处理,降低主操作的响应时间。定期监控触发器的执行情况,及时发现并优化低效的触发器逻辑,也是保持系统稳定运行的重要手段。


AI绘图,仅供参考

  在存储优化方面,触发器还可以与其他技术结合使用,如索引优化和分区表。合理的索引设计可以加快触发器中查询的速度,而分区表则能提高大规模数据操作的效率。这些综合措施有助于构建高效、稳定的MsSql数据库系统。

(编辑:草根网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章